Abstract

Equipment capable of performing multi cycle experiments on pulse detonation engines are constructed and put together. The engine is capable of running up to 40 Hz, and operates both without any valves and with a reed valve. No clean detonations are obtained, but local peak pressures comparable to those of detonations are obtained. Pressure recordings indicate that premature burning in large parts of the engine can be one reason for the lack of detonations propagating through the whole length of the engine.
